Bang, Bang Chicken and Shrimp - Cheesecake Factory Copycat

Curry Coconut Sauce:
  • 1 tsp Olive Oil
  • 1 tsp Sesame Oil
  • 1/8 tsp Red Pepper Flakes
  • 2 cloves Garlic minced
  • 1 small Onion chopped
  • 1 tsp Ginger minced
  • 1/2 C Water
  • 1/2 tsp ground Cumin
  • 1/2 tsp ground Coriander
  • 1 tsp Paprika
  • 1/4 tsp Salt or to taste
  • 1/4 tsp Pepper or to taste
  • 1/4 tsp Allspice
  • 1/4 tsp Turmeric
  • 14 fl oz Coconut Milk (1 can- not a carton!)
  • 1 small Zucchini (julienned)
  • 1 medium Carrot (julienned)
  • 1/2 C Peas (Frozen)
Peanut Sauce
  • 1/4 C Peanut Butter, creamy
  • 2 Tbsp Water
  • 1 Tbsp Sugar
  • 1 Tbsp Soy Sauce, reduce salt
  • 1 tsp Rice Vinegar
  • 1 tsp Lime Juice
  • 1/8 tsp Red Pepper Flakes
Chicken and Shrimp
  • 2 Chicken Breast, cut into bite size pieces
  • 10 medium Shrimp, shelled
  • 1/4 C Cornstarch
  • 2 Tbsp Vegetable Oil
  • 2 C Rice Cooked
Garnish
  • 1/2 C Flaked Coconut, toasted
  • 1/4 C Peanuts, chopped
  • 2 Green Onion, julienned or chopped
  • Sesame Seeds, optional
Coconut Curry 
  1. In a medium sauce pan heat the olive oil, sesame oil and crushed red pepper flakes over medium heat.  
  2. Add chopped onions, garlic and ginger and cook until onion is translucent.  
  3. Add spices and water and stir well then bring to a boil. Add the coconut milk and bring mixture back to a boil. Reduce heat and simmer for about 20 minutes or until sauce thickens.  
  4. Add julienned carrots and zucchini, then peas.  Cook for another 10 minutes or until carrots are tender.

Chicken and Shrimp Instructions:
  1. Heat 2 tbsp. of vegetable oil in a large skillet. 
  2. Season chicken pieces and shrimp generously with salt and pepper.  Sprinkle the cornstarch over chicken and shrimp and toss, making sure each piece is fully coated in cornstarch.  
  3. Add the coated chicken to the skillet and cook for a couple of minutes per side, until slightly golden.  
  4. Remove from skillet and add shrimp.  Cook shrimp for a couple minutes until slightly pink and remove from skillet. Set aside.
Peanut Sauce.
  1. To make the peanut sauce add all ingredients in a small sauce pan and heat just until the mixture begins to bubble take off from heat right away; cover and remove pan from heat.

Assemble on plate as follows:
  • Rice
  • Chicken & Shrimp
  • Coconut Curry
  • Peanut Sauce
  • Peanuts, sesame seeds, green onions and coconut
Prep Time: 20 minutes
Cook Time: 40 minutes
Total Time: 1 hour
Yield: 5 servings

Macros: 52F/51C/14P
Calories: 703kcal

Ham Fried Rice


Ingredients

  • 3 cups uncooked rice 
  • 3 tablespoons oil 
  • 2 teaspoons garlic minced 
  • 1 packet fried rice seasoning 
  • 1/4 cup soy sauce 
  • 4 eggs 
  • 1 cup thick cut deli ham 
  • 2 cups peas 
  • 5 green onions 
  • salt and pepper to taste 


Instructions

  1. If you aren't using leftover rice, start your rice cooking. While rice is cooking, chop meat and onions into small pieces. Scramble eggs and scoop off onto a plate. I use frozen peas, so I thaw them under some cool water at this point as well.
  2. When rice is prepared, heat oil, garlic and onions in your pan. Add rice. 
  3. Gradually add in fried rice packet and soy sauce. Once well mixed add all remaining ingredients and salt and pepper to taste. Enjoy!

Prep time: 5 minutes
Cooke time: 15 minutes
Total time 20 minutes

Lo Mein Instant Pot

Ingredients:
  • 2 tbsp sesame oil
  • 2 cloves garlic (minced)
  • 1/2 cup red onion (diced)
  • 2 cups mushrooms (sliced)
  • 1 cup carrots (julienned)
  • 1 cup snow peas
  • 2 tbsp rice wine vinegar
  • 1 1 /2 cup vegetable stock
  • Juice of 1 lemon
  • 3 tbsp soy sauce
  • 1/3 cup brown sugar
  • 8 oz lo mein/rice noodles
  • salt & pepper to taste

Directions:
  1. Sauté sesame oil, garlic and onion until tender in the instant pot
  2. Add rice wine vinegar, vegetable stock lemon juice soy sauce and brown sugar. Mix until blended well.
  3. Add uncooked lo mein/rice noodles
  4. Add carrots, mushrooms and snow peas
  5. Lock lid and set vent to seal
  6. Press manual button and set to high for 5 minutes
  7. Quick pressure release carefully
  8. Serve and enjoy

Chicken Curry


Ingredients:

  • 1 tsp Fresh grated ginger
  • ½ cup Onion, chopped
  • 4 Carrots, peeled and sliced
  • 1 Tbsp Curry Powder
  • ½ tsp Ground Cumin
  • ¼ tsp smoked paprika
  • Juice of 1 lime
  • 1 Tbsp Chicken Bouillon Base
  • 1 Cup Water
  • 4 Thin slicked chicken breast, thawed
  • 2 Potatos, 1 inch diced
  • 1 large red pepper, diced
  • 14 oz can coconut milk
  • 14 oz can diced tomatoes
  • 1 tsp salt
  • ½ tsp pepper
  • 1 cup frozen peas
  • Cilantro, chopped

Instructions:

1. In a stovetop or electric pressure cooker, heat the oil (use the Saute function on the Instant Pot) until rippling and hot. Add the curry powder and cook, stirring constantly, for 30-45 seconds.  Add the onion and ginger.  Cook another 30 seconds, stirring constantly.  Add the carrots, bouillon, cumin, paprika and water and heat for 10 minutes.

2. Add the lime, chicken, potatoes, red pepper, coconut milk, tomatoes, salt and pepper.  Close the lid on the pressure cooker and cook on high pressure for 4 minutes (hit manuel and adjust time to 5 minutes).  On the Stove top, bring to a boil and cook until chicken and potatoes are done- about 20 minutes.

3. Let the pressure naturally release before removing the lid.  Once done, stir in peas and cilantro.  Serve over hot, cooked rice or quinoa.

Takes about 1 hour 45 minutes to make start to finish.

Tips:

·       When cooking with butter, heat pan up with butter in it.

·       When cooking with oil, add the oil after the pan is hot.

·       The more you mince garlic the stronger it is.

·       Add 2 Tbsp of kosher salt to the water per pound of pasta
